Tennessee Gas Pipeline Company Recognized for Outstanding Safety AchievementHOUSTON, TEXAS, May 24, 2004—Tennessee Gas Pipeline
Company, a subsidiary of El Paso Corporation (NYSE:EP), was recognized
today as an industry leader in safe operations by the American Gas
Association (AGA). At a ceremony in Phoenix, company executives accepted
the 2003 AGA Safety Achievement Award for achieving the lowest lost time
incident rate among very large transmission companies. During 2003,
Tennessee Gas Pipeline employees worked more than three million hours and
had only six reportable lost time incidents.

AGA has recognized Tennessee's safety achievements 11 times over the
past 14 years. In congratulating Tennessee's employees on their
accomplishment, AGA emphasized the contribution the company's excellent
safety performance has made to the pipeline industry's record as one of the
safest forms of transportation.
